Files
DocERP/docs/Lexema-ERP/Автотранспорт/Автотранспорт.md

158 lines
19 KiB
Markdown
Raw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

# Автотранспорт
## Форма для ввода пробега техники
Документ «Форма для ввода пробега техники» предназначен для отражения всех маршрутов движения техники в течении отчетного периода (месяца) и формирования путевых листов на основании введенной информации.
![Рисунок 1 Реестр документа «Форма для ввода пробега техники»](image.png)
Для формирования документа необходимо указать в шапке:
- Дату документа
- Период с / по
- Автомобиль
- Водитель
- Показания одометра на начало
- Показания одометра на конец
- Остаток ГСМ на начало
- Статус документа
![Рисунок 2 Форма документа «Форма для ввода пробега техники»](image-1.png)
При вводе периода и выборе автомобиля автоматически заполняются поля : «показания одометра на начало», «остаток ГСМ на начало» и «заправлено».
Данные для полей «показания одометра на начало», «остаток ГСМ на начало» подтягиваются из последнего путевого листа с датой выезда до начала указанного периода. Есть возможность редактировать эти поля вручную.
Данные для поля «заправлено» подтягиваются из раздаточных ведомостей по указанному автомобилю с датами заправки - в пределах указанного периода.
При вводе значений в поля «показания одометра на начало» и «показания одометра на конец» автоматически рассчитываются значения полей «Пробег за период» и «Расход по норме». «Пробег за период» рассчитывается как разница «показаний одометра на конец» и «показаний одометра на начало». «Расход по норме» рассчитывается согласно нормам расхода топлива на пробег на указанный автомобиль на начало указанного периода, с учетом зимнего коэффициента.
При изменении значений полей «Остаток ГСМ на начало», «Заправлено», «Расход по норме» автоматически рассчитывается значение поля «Остаток ГСМ на конец».
В табличной части документа необходимо выбрать маршруты движения из справочника, указать «количество поездок за период» для каждого маршрута. В столбец «Расстояние» значение подтягивается из справочника маршрутов, но есть возможность это значение изменить вручную.
Столбец «Итого пройдено по маршруту» рассчитывается как произведение столбцов «Расстояние» и «количество поездок за период».
Необходимо добиться, чтобы сумма по всем строкам по столбцу «Итого пройдено по маршруту» была равна значению поля «Пробег за период» в шапке документа.
В строках, которыми должны будут начинаться путевые листы, необходимо установить флаг в столбце «Стартовый маршрут».
В строках, которыми должны будут заканчиваться путевые листы, необходимо установить флаг в столбце «Финишный маршрут».
После заполнения документа необходимо нажать кнопку "Сформировать ПЛ" на верхней панели инструментов. В результате будут сформированы путевые листы по указанному автомобилю и указанному водителю в рабочие дни указанного периода с указанными маршрутами.
Для каждого путевого листа маршруты подбираются по следующему алгоритму: находится строка, у которой установлен флаг в столбце «Стартовый маршрут», вставляется в путевой лист первым нарядом в таблицу «Заказчики». Из этой строки находится конечная точка (столбец «Куда»), назовем её «Точка 2». Далее ищется строка, в которой в столбце «Откуда» - значение нашей «Точки 2» и не установлен флаг «Финишный маршрут». Если находится такая строка, то вставляется в путевой лист вторым нарядом. Из неё находится «Точка 3». И так далее, пока цикл не дойдёт до строки с установленным флагом «Финишный маршрут». Если не нашлась такая строка, то ищется строка , в которой в столбце «Откуда» - значение нашей «Точки 2» и установлен флаг «Финишный маршрут». Если находится такая строка, то вставляется в путевой лист вторым, последним нарядом.
Если в результате подбора маршрутов получается хотя бы один путевой лист, в котором нет строки с «Финишным маршрутом» или нет строки со «Стартовым маршрутом», то ни один путевой лист не создается и программа выдает ошибку с соответствующим текстом.
Все строки из раздаточных ведомостей по указанному автомобилю за указанный период будут вставлены в путевые листы с соответствующими датами в таблицу заправок. Если в раздаточной ведомости указанная дата заправки является выходным или праздничным днём, то эти строки будут вставлены в путевые листы с ближайшими последующими датами. Если же таковых не будет, тогда строки из раздаточных ведомостей будут вставлены в путевые листы с ближайшими предыдущими датами. Все заправки в пределах каждого путевого листа группируются по видам топлива и общее количество каждого вида топлива записывается в столбец «Заправка» в таблицу «Движение ГСМ» в строку с соответствующим видом топлива.
В сформированных путевых листах автоматически рассчитываются нормы расхода топлива для каждого наряда и общее количество нормативного расхода топлива записывается в таблицу «Движение ГСМ» в столбцы «Расход факт» и «Расход норма».
В каждом путевом листе в таблице «Движение ГСМ» по каждому виду топлива рассчитывается «Остаток топлива при заезде» по формуле : «Остаток топлива при заезде» = «Остаток топлива при выезде» - «Расход факт» + «Заправлено».
В первом по дате сформированном путевом листе значения полей «Показание одометра на начало» и «Остаток топлива при выезде» будут соответствовать полям из шапки документа «Форма для ввода пробега техники». В каждом следующем путевом листе «показания одометра на начало» и «Остаток топлива при выезде» копируются с предыдущего путевого листа соответственно с «показания одометра на конец» и «Остаток топлива при заезде».
## Виды топлива
В зависимости от типа двигателя и конструкции автомобиля используются разные виды топлива.
Справочник "Виды топлива" нужен для заполнения существующих в системе видов топлива.
Для того, чтобы создать новый вид топлива нужно нажать "Создать".
![Форма создания вида топлива](image-3.png)
Документ содержит поля: **Наименование**, **Ед. измерения**, **Тип топлива**.
Нужно ввести наименование, выбрать единицу измерения из выпадающего списка и выбрать тип топлива из выпадающего списка. Нажать сохранить. После чего в реестре отобразится только что созданный документ.
## Виды топлива с номенклатурой
После нажатия на кнопку "Создать" открывается документ "Виды топлива с номенклатурой".
Нужно ввести существующий вид топлива, а также выбрать его в существующей номенклатуре. Нажать сохранить.
![Форма создания вида топлива с номенклатурой](image-4.png)
В реестре должен появиться только что созданный документ.
## Подвижной состав
При открытии реестра отображаются уже загруженные и доступные для использования подвижные составы.
![Реестр подвижного состава](image-5.png)
При необходимости можно добавить недостающие "Подвижные составы" через кнопку "Создать".
![Форма создания подвижного состава](image-6.png)
Документ имеет вкладки: **Подвижной состав**, **Паспорт транспортного средства**, **Закрепленные водители**, **Закрепление за подразделением**, **Страхование и лицензия**, **ТО**, **Собственник**.
## Справочник маршрутов автотранспорта
Для создания нового маршрута нажимаем "Создать". Указываем наименование маршрута, указываем точку "Откуда", адрес заполнится автоматически, указываем точку "куда", адрес заполнится автоматически, указываем расстояние.
Маршрут прописывается в формате от точки А в точку Б, потом из точки Б в точку А, так же можно добавить промежуточные точки.
![Форма создания маршрута](image-7.png)
**Примечание 1**: Точки откуда и куда указываются только уже существующие в программе.
## Справочник топливных карт
![Форма топливной карты](image-8.png)
Для создания документа топливной карты необходимо нажать создать, затем указать номер карты и водителя, нажать сохранить. Новый документ появится в реестре.
## Раздаточная ведомость
Раздаточная ведомость нужна для учета выдачи топлива (ГСМ).
При создании раздаточной ведомости заполняется информация о заправке: **Топливная карта**, **Дата заправки**, **Водитель**, **Автомобиль (марка и гос. номер заполняются автоматически)**, **Вид топлива**, **Номенклатура**, **ЕИ**, **Кол-во**, **сумма**.
![Форма раздаточной ведомости](image-9.png)
## Приказ о вводе зимнего коэффициента
Зимний коэффициент — это поправочный множитель, увеличивающий норму расхода топлива в холодное время года. Он компенсирует повышенный расход горючего из-за низких температур, зимних условий эксплуатации и дополнительных нагрузок на двигатель.
![Форма приказа](image-10.png)
При создании нового документа, открывается форма с полями: **Номер**, **Дата документа (заполняется дата на сегодня)**, **С какого и по какое число действует приказ**, **Причина приказа и регион**.
## Путевой лист
Путевой лист — это официальный документ, который оформляется для учета работы транспортного средства, водителя и контроля за выполнением перевозок. Он является обязательным для юридических лиц и индивидуальных предпринимателей, использующих автотранспорт в коммерческих или служебных целях.
Документ "Путевой лист" состоит из двух частей: **Шапки и табличной части**.
В шапке указаны такие поля как: **Номер**, **Дата документа**, **Дата выезда и заезда**, **Статус**, **Примечание**, **Одометр. начало и конец**, **Техника и маршрут**, а также чек-бокс **Многодневный путевой лист**.
![Шапка путевого листа](image-11.png)
Табличная часть состоит из вкладок: Водители, заказчики, движение ГСМ, заправка.
![Вкладки путевого листа](image-12.png)
## Форма для ввода пробега техники
Форма для ввода пробега техники — это специальный раздел в путевом листе или другом учетном документе, предназначенный для фиксации показаний одометра (счетчика пробега) транспортного средства.
Форма включает в себя реестр маршрутов за определенный промежуток времени.
Документ "форма для ввода пробега техники" состоит из двух частей: **Шапки и табличной части**.
![Форма ввода пробега](image-13.png)
В шапке документа указаны такие поля как: **Номер**, **Дата документа (автоматически заполняется дата на сегодня)**, **Статус документа**, **Период**, **Автомобиль**, **Водитель**, **Одометр на начало и конец**, **Остаток ГСМ на начало и конец**, **Заправлено**, **Пробег за период**, **Расход по норме**, **Кол-во рабочих дней в месяце**.
В табличной части документа указаны перемещения маршрута "Откуда" - "Куда". (Маршрут должен быть обязательно от точки "А" до точки "Б" и наоборот).
Любой маршрут обязательно включает в себя стартовую точку (стартовый маршрут) и финишную точку (финишный маршрут). Так же маршрут может включать в себя промежуточные пункты, в этом случае маршрут должен быть в формате: Водитель выехал из точки "А" (стартовый маршрут), доехал до промежуточного маршрута в точку "С" и из точки "С" поехал в точку "Б" (финишный маршрут) и наоборот.
![Табличная часть формы пробега](image-14.png)
## Движение топлива из путевых листов
Движение топлива из путевых листов — это учет расхода горюче-смазочных материалов (ГСМ) на основе данных, зафиксированных в путевых листах. Этот процесс включает контроль выдачи, списания и анализа потребления топлива транспортным средством в ходе рейсов.
Для того, чтобы сформировать отчет нужно выставить период и нажать сформировать.
![Отчет по движению топлива](image-15.png)